在开发过程中,我们经常需要在不同的PHP版本之间切换。本文将详细介绍如何在终端中轻松切换PHP版本,让你的开发过程更加顺畅。
一、查看已安装的PHP版本
首先,我们需要查看当前系统中已安装的PHP版本。在终端中输入以下命令:
php -v
执行后,你将看到类似以下的输出:
PHP 7.2.14 (cli) (built: Jul 5 2018 19:11:26) ( NTS )
Copyright (c) 1997-2018 The PHP Group
Zend Engine v3.2.0 with Zend OPcache v7.2.14
二、查找可用的PHP版本
接下来,我们需要查找系统中可用的PHP版本。在终端中输入以下命令:
ls /usr/bin/php*
执行后,你将看到类似以下的输出:
/usr/bin/php-7.2:
/usr/bin/php-7.2-cgi:
/usr/bin/php-7.2-fpm:
/usr/bin/php-7.2-json:
/usr/bin/php-7.2-readline:
/usr/bin/php-7.3:
/usr/bin/php-7.3-cgi:
/usr/bin/php-7.3-fpm:
/usr/bin/php-7.3-json:
/usr/bin/php-7.3-readline:
三、切换PHP版本
现在,我们可以选择一个可用的PHP版本进行切换。例如,我们想要切换到PHP 7.3版本,可以在终端中输入以下命令:
alias php='php-7.3'
执行后,当你在终端中输入php
时,实际上会运行php-7.3
。如果你想切换回原来的PHP版本,只需删除刚才添加的别名即可:
unalias php
四、永久切换PHP版本(推荐)
为了方便以后的使用,我们可以将上述命令添加到~/.bashrc
文件中,实现永久切换。首先,打开~/.bashrc
文件:
nano ~/.bashrc
然后,在文件末尾添加以下内容:
alias php='php-7.3'
保存并退出编辑器。最后,让修改生效:
source ~/.bashrc
至此,你已经学会了如何在终端中轻松切换PHP版本。希望本文对你有所帮助,祝你开发愉快!